How the formula works
Both decigram per imperial gallon and decagram per cubic yard meas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in decigram per imperial gallon by 1.681786 to get decagram per cubic yard. To reverse the conversion, multiply a decagram per cubic yard value by 0.594606 to get back to decigram per imperial gallon.
